温馨提示×

tomcat启动报错如何解决

小亿
297
2023-09-13 11:34:36
栏目: 编程语言

当Tomcat启动时报错,解决方法通常包括以下步骤:

  1. 检查Tomcat日志:查看Tomcat启动日志(通常位于Tomcat安装目录下的logs文件夹中),寻找报错信息和异常堆栈跟踪,以确定具体的错误原因。

  2. 检查端口冲突:确保Tomcat要使用的端口没有被其他应用程序占用。可以通过运行命令netstat -ano(Windows)或lsof -i :<端口号>(Linux/Mac)来检查端口占用情况,并根据需要更改Tomcat配置文件中的端口号。

  3. 检查Java环境:确保Java环境配置正确。可以使用java -version命令来验证Java版本是否正确安装,并确保JAVA_HOME环境变量已正确设置。

  4. 检查配置文件:检查Tomcat的配置文件(如server.xml)是否正确配置。特别注意查看Connector和Context等元素的配置是否正确,确保路径、端口、数据库连接等配置项正确无误。

  5. 检查应用程序:如果启动报错是由于应用程序错误引起的,可以尝试禁用或删除应用程序,再次启动Tomcat,看是否能正常启动。如果可以,再逐步检查应用程序的配置和代码,修复错误。

  6. 更新Tomcat版本:如果以上方法都无法解决问题,可以尝试升级Tomcat版本,以解决可能的Bug或兼容性问题。

如果以上方法仍然无法解决Tomcat启动报错问题,可以将具体的错误信息和异常堆栈跟踪提供出来,以便更准确地定位问题并提供解决方案。

0